América and Toluca are set to face each other once again in a title match, this time for the Campeón de Campeones. This matchup is particularly exciting as it serves as a ‘rematch’ of the recently concluded Clausura 2025 Final, wherein Toluca clinched the Liga MX championship against América. Despite this recent setback, America’s historical performance in finals against Toluca gives them an edge, having emerged victorious in two out of three encounters.
In their first final clash during the 1970-71 season, América defeated Toluca with a global score of 2-0, marking América’s second title in the Primera División. The upcoming match offers a chance for América to renew their legacy, particularly after Toluca’s recent win, which could equal the finals record between these two storied teams.
In addition to their league matchups, the two clubs have faced off in an international final as well. In 2006, América triumphed over Toluca in the Concacaf Champions League, a victory that not only highlighted América’s prowess but also qualified them for the Club World Cup.
The historical records of their encounters in finals showcase a competitive rivalry, with the following results:
– América 2-0 Toluca | Liga MX 1970-1971
– América 2-1 Toluca | Concachampions 2006
– Toluca 2-0 América | Liga MX Clausura 2025
